
WebKit
得一录
这个作者很懒,什么都没留下…
展开
-
WebKit之调试
下面是我调试WebKit 看到的文章,翻译下,希望对大家有用! 在Windows上调试 1.打开WebKit/WebKit/win/WebKit.vcproj/WebKit.sln 你可以用Visual Studio 2005打开工程,也可以用Visual C++ Express 2005打开. 如果你在找.vsprops文件时发现了错误, 运行update-webkit,然后关闭,翻译 2011-11-08 17:13:30 · 3140 阅读 · 0 评论 -
vs2008去掉"正在更新IntelliSense"
在编译ChromeOS 与WebKit的时候,每次都会出现这样的问题,而且一等就好长时间, 见天从网上找了个解决方案: 解决方法就是将/Microsoft Visual Studio 9.0/VC/vcpackages/feacp.dll改名,或者直接删除.反正用Visual Assist完全可以取代VS这个功能了. 不过我一般改成feacp.dll.back. 因为以后的ATL控件还会用转载 2011-11-08 16:22:28 · 2859 阅读 · 0 评论 -
Webkit之网络模块
根据项目需要: 介绍下Loader模块和Network模块: Loader模块是Network模块的客户。Network模块提供了资源的获取和上传功能,获取的资源可能来自网络,本地文件或者缓存。 Network目录下的ResourceHandleClient类是ResourceHandle类的客户,它定义了一些列的虚函数,这些虚函数是ResourceHandle的回调,继承类实现这些接口原创 2011-12-08 11:36:57 · 2454 阅读 · 0 评论 -
一个Http请求在WebCore中的主要流程
1.通过向服务器发送请求 2.服务器通过请求,发送给客户端的HTML的内容 3.浏览器把接收到的内容解析成DOM树,解析成DOM树的同时生成Render树 4.布局管理器通过Render树布局,这是一个动态的过程,DOM在这个时候会继续向服务器申请自己需要的东西. 5.最后将整个网页Render出来.转载 2012-03-31 10:06:49 · 1081 阅读 · 0 评论 -
WebKit android介绍
WebKit – WebKit For Android Posted by admin on May 10, 2010 in Android, WebKit, 浏览器 | Subscribe 如需转载,请注明出处! WebSite: http://www.jjos.org/ 作者: 姜江 linuxemacs@gmail.com QQ: 457283 这是一篇自己写于一年前转载 2012-04-16 08:10:25 · 1008 阅读 · 0 评论 -
webkit Bug问题定位
项目中经常需要定位WebKit Bug 的产生原因, WebKit Bug问题定位的方法,缩小范围是不错的应对措施. 在处理大页面的问题就很有效. 1.问题预判 基于web的应用本身不够严格,页面本身,可能就存在问题,所以,首先要借助各类浏览器,来查看总体的情况,界定是页面本身的问题,还是浏览器的问题。 2.问题范围确定 浏览器的问题,可以划分为网络问题,排版问题,原创 2012-05-02 22:34:32 · 1214 阅读 · 0 评论 -
WebKit调试
对于Android中的Webkit(libwebcore.so),因为它是系统底层的库,所以没有办法像App和Frameworks那样直接用Eclipse来调试,因为它们都是C和C++语言,所以对于它来讲只能用GDB来进行调试。 何时用到GDB来调试 个人认为,并不是所有问题都立马上GDB来调试。因为Webkit的代码十分巨大逻辑也十分的复杂,所以直接用GDB,可能不是很直观,你无法在转载 2013-03-28 08:41:05 · 732 阅读 · 0 评论 -
WebKit渲染
转:http://blog.youkuaiyun.com/milado_nju/article/details/7292131 # WebKit渲染基础 ## 概述 WebKit是一个引擎,而不是一个浏览器,它专注于网页内容展示,其中渲染是其中核心的部分之一。本章着重于对渲染部分的基础进行一定程度的了解和认识,主要理解基于DOM树来介绍Render树和RenderLayer树的构建由来和方式转载 2013-08-15 13:22:41 · 637 阅读 · 0 评论